- To burst
- To continue
- To stop
- To flow
Read More About This Mcq.
Zam Zam means “to stop.”The Zamzam Well is located within the Masjid al-Haram in Mecca, Saudi Arabia.It 20 meters (66 feet) east of the Kaaba.Millions of pilgrims visit the well each year during Hajj or Umrah to drink its water. |